🔍 AI Impact Analysis

With a risk score of 48/100, Electrical and Electronics Repairers, Commercial and Industrial Equipment faces moderate automation pressure. While tasks like predictive maintenance ai reducing reactive repair needs are increasingly handled by AI, the role retains significant human elements. The 59,990 workers in this occupation should focus on strengthening skills in working in confined, elevated, or hazardous spaces and adapting repairs to non-standard or legacy equipment to stay ahead. The role will likely evolve rather than disappear.

⚠️ Top Risk Factors

1

Predictive maintenance AI reducing reactive repair needs

2

Robotic inspection of hard-to-reach equipment

3

Augmented reality-guided remote diagnostics

4

Automated fault detection via IoT sensor networks

🛡️ Tasks Safe from Automation

Working in confined, elevated, or hazardous spaces

Adapting repairs to non-standard or legacy equipment

Customer communication about technical issues

Diagnosing novel equipment failures through physical inspection
